Revitalizing Education: The City of Novocherkassk’s Department Embraces Innovative Content Creation Strategies
The Shift Towards Digital Learning Resources
The Novocherkassk Department of Education is undergoing a notable transformation, moving away from traditional, static learning materials towards dynamic, engaging content. This initiative isn’t simply about adopting new technology; it’s a fundamental shift in pedagogical approach, prioritizing student engagement and personalized learning experiences. Key to this change is a focused effort on innovative content creation.
This move is driven by several factors, including:
Increased Accessibility: Digital resources can be accessed anytime, anywhere, breaking down geographical barriers to education.
Enhanced engagement: Interactive content, such as videos, simulations, and gamified learning modules, captures student attention more effectively than traditional textbooks.
Personalized Learning: Digital platforms allow educators to tailor content to individual student needs and learning styles.
cost-Effectiveness: While initial investment may be required, digital resources can often be updated and distributed more cheaply than printed materials.
Core Strategies for Content Creation
The Novocherkassk Department is employing a multi-faceted strategy for content creation, focusing on empowering teachers and leveraging readily available tools. This includes:
Teacher Training Workshops: Intensive workshops are being conducted to equip educators with the skills needed to create high-quality digital learning materials. These workshops cover topics like video editing,graphic design,and interactive content progress.
Open Educational Resources (OER) Integration: A strong emphasis is placed on utilizing and adapting existing OER materials. This reduces the burden on teachers and ensures access to a wide range of vetted resources. Platforms like Merlot and OER Commons are actively promoted.
Internal Content Repository: The department is building a centralized repository for sharing best practices and collaboratively developed content. This fosters a community of practice and prevents duplication of effort.
Microlearning Modules: Breaking down complex topics into bite-sized microlearning modules is proving highly effective. These short, focused lessons are ideal for mobile learning and reinforce key concepts.
Utilizing Accessible Technology: The department prioritizes tools that are accessible to all students, including those with disabilities. This includes ensuring content is compatible with screen readers and offers alternative formats.
Tools & Technologies Driving the Change
Several specific tools and technologies are central to Novocherkassk’s content creation strategy:
Video Creation & Editing Software: Tools like Adobe Premiere Rush, Filmora, and even mobile apps are being used to create engaging video lessons and tutorials.
Interactive Presentation Software: Platforms like Prezi and Genially are replacing traditional PowerPoint presentations with dynamic, visually appealing alternatives.
Learning management Systems (LMS): Moodle and Canvas are being utilized to deliver content, track student progress, and facilitate online collaboration.
graphic Design Tools: Canva is a popular choice for creating visually appealing infographics, posters, and other learning materials.
Screen Recording Software: Loom and Screencast-O-Matic are used to create fast tutorials and demonstrations.

Addressing Challenges & Future Directions
The transition isn’t without its challenges. Ensuring equitable access to technology and reliable internet connectivity remains a key concern. Moreover, ongoing professional development is crucial to keep teachers up-to-date with the latest tools and techniques.
Looking ahead,the Novocherkassk Department plans to:
Expand the OER Repository: Continue to curate and contribute to a extensive collection of high-quality OER materials.
Integrate Artificial Intelligence (AI): Explore the potential of AI-powered tools to personalize learning experiences and automate content creation tasks.
Develop Virtual reality (VR) & Augmented Reality (AR) Content: Investigate the use of immersive technologies to create engaging and interactive learning environments.
Focus on Data Analytics: Utilize data analytics to track student progress, identify areas for advancement, and refine content creation strategies. Educational data mining will be a key focus.
